14得票2回答
React Native Maps:自定义标记导致Android设备极度卡顿和变慢

我在地图上加载了大约2000个标记。一开始它运行得很好,但是后来就会急剧变慢。要修复它,我需要清除应用程序数据,然后它只能再次像以前一样工作几秒钟。const mapMarkers = [ {id: 1, code: "603778", lat: 35.761791, lng: 51....

14得票1回答
navigator.geolocation.watchPosition每100米才返回一次信息

我在我的React Native项目中使用navigator.geolocation.watchPosition函数,在用户移动时在地图上绘制路径。我注意到这个函数的返回频率非常低。当我使用iOS模拟器和GPS模拟器中的“高速公路驾驶”模式进行测试时,我以为至少是频率的问题。现在当我改用“城市...

13得票5回答
React Native中的navigator.geolocation.getCurrentPosition无法工作

我正在使用一个真实的安卓设备(版本5.1) 我能够使用react-native-maps确定我的位置(正确地在我的应用程序中显示蓝点位置),并且我能够使用谷歌地图应用程序并进入我的位置(GPS正常工作)。 我尝试了很多方法,比如使用大的超时时间、切换enableHighAccuracy选项...

13得票2回答
将区域的纬度差/经度差转换为近似的缩放级别

我在一个React Native应用程序上使用来自Airbnb的优秀组件库react-native-maps。我的JSON文件中有一组地图标记,每个标记都有一个名为zoom的属性,该属性是一个整数,表示标记在地图上应显示/隐藏的近似缩放级别。 基于Region的latitudeDelta和lo...

13得票6回答
React-Native-Maps:如何动态移动到指定坐标?

我正在使用以下代码,但没有成功: //在NativeBase容器内部 <MapView.Animated ref="map" style = {styles.map} showsUserLocation =...

12得票1回答
使用react-native-maps和use_frameworks时,Pod安装错误`React/RCTView.h'文件未找到。

我似乎无法使用pod install将react-native-maps安装到我的React Native iOS项目中。 我收到了警告 Missing dependency target "React" 和 React/RCTView.h' file not found 的错误信息。 ht...

12得票1回答
React Native Maps - 新的定价

自从Google切换他们的定价模式后,移动本地地图仍然是无限制的,而JavaScript SDK地图每月限制为28,000次,您可以在此处查看:here。 请问react-native-maps属于哪个类别?谢谢。

11得票7回答
如何使用react-native-maps获取当前位置

我正在尝试在安卓设备上使用react-native maps将地图渲染到当前用户的地理位置。 这是我目前已经完成的内容:import React, { Component } from 'react'; import { View, StyleSheet, Dimensions...

11得票1回答
我应该如何在React Native中Google地图上实现可拖动、可缩放的多边形?

我正在使用React Native创建一个应用程序,其中一部分是由多边形表示的地理围栏,我希望用户能够轻松地使用手指拖动和调整多边形的大小。 Google Maps API文档提供了一个使用纯JavaScript进行拖动(但不支持调整大小)多边形的清晰示例。然而,由于在React中直接集成G...

11得票7回答
React Native Maps标记自定义图像无法从默认值更改

我已经花了大约5个小时尝试许多不同的代码排列组合,并进行重建,但我无法改变反应本地地图中默认的“红色指针”标记作为默认的标记图像。import MapView, { PROVIDER_GOOGLE } from 'react-native-maps'; ... <MapView ...